Cajun style Fish with Pineapple sauce




Today’ recipe is a Cajun style fish, to go along with it I’m making  a delicious sweet and sour pineapple Salsa, this is the perfect combo to make some amazing Tacos.  This is so easy to make, so full of flavor and easy enough to make any day of the week.


Ingredients:
  • 4-5 Fish Fillets
  • 2 tspn Paprika
  • 2 tspn Brown Sugar
  • 1 tspn Dry Oregano
  • 1 tspn Ground Garlic
  • ½ tspn Ground Cumin
  • ¼ tspn Cayenne Pepper
  • Salt
  • Black Pepper
  • +2 T Coconut Oil


Ingredients for the Salsa
  •  3 Pineapple slices
  • 3 Tomatoes cut in quarters
  • 1 Small Onion cut in half
  • 1 Garlic Cloves
  • ¼ C Chopped Cilantro
  • 3-5 Jalapeño Peppers
  • ½  T Coconut Oil



Prepare the Fish: Combine all spices and season with salt and pepper to taste. Rub this mixture onto the fish  let it rest for about 5-10 minutes before cooking.


Make the Salsa: In a skillet heat up the oil, and saute the tomatoes, onion and peppers for 3 minutes, then add in the garlic and continue to saute for 2-3 more minutes. Then transfer to a blender. In the same skillet heat up the pineapple for about 1-2 minutes on each side, just to soften it a bit. Add two of the pineapple slices into the blender with the rest of the ingredients, also add some cilantro, and season with salt and pepper to taste, blend for a few seconds, until you get a thick and chunky salsa.  (do not add any water at all to blend the ingredients, you are looking for a really thick and chunky consistency).


Chop the rest of the pineapple into small cubes and combine with the salsa, taste the flavor add more salt and pepper if needed. Reserve until you are ready to use it.


Fry the Fish: Heat up the oil, and fry the fish for about 2-4 minutes on each side or until well cooked.

Then serve, top the fish with plenty of the Salsa and Enjoy!
